    HSBC Holdings PLC (LON:HSBA) logged a sharp jump in its fourth-quarter profit on Tuesday as rising interest rates greatly boosted its net interest income, while the bank also flagged a special dividend on the sale of its Canadian business. HSBC’s profit before tax for the three months to December 31 jumped 92% to $5.2 billion,

    Housing sales across top seven cities rose 71 per cent year-on-year in 2021 to 2,36,530 units, but demand fell short of pre-Covid levels by 10 per cent, according to Anarock. Housing sales stood at 1,38,350 units in 2020 and 2,61,358 units in the 2019 calendar year. Mumbai-based Anarock attributed the rise in housing sales to very low interest
